2024 Shelby Mustang Mach-E GT Debuts As First-Ever All-Electric Shelby

After more than a decade since his passing, Carroll Shelby’s name is still respected in the automotive world, often hailed as one of the most influential automotive innovators the world has ever seen. To celebrate Mr. Shelby's 100th birthday this year, Shelby American launches its first-ever all-electric model, dubbed as the Shelby Mustang Mach-E GT.

Interestingly, this souped-up EV will be available exclusively for the European market. And frankly, the Americans only got themselves to blame, because Shelby’s decision to not sell its EV on home soil is due to the nation’s slow adoption of EVs, which translates to lower demands for such cars.


Moving on to the vehicle itself, the Shelby Mustang Mach-E GT is more than just a rebadge, as it features a slew lightweight parts and equipment. Based on the standard Ford Mustang Mach-E GT, Shelby swaps both the standard hood and front grille for  carbon fibre ones. Elsewhere, the Shelby Mach-E also comes with carbon fibre front splitter, side cladding, as well as mirror caps.

Another notable exterior styling cues is the Shelby’s signature racing stripe, which runs across the car’s side profile instead from the hood to the back of the roof, like in many older Shelby Mustang models. What’s so special about this decal is that its hue matches the original Shelby Le Mans-winning model – a special homage to the brand’s historical successes in motorsports.


Of course, this special model rides on a special set of lightweight wheels, featuring multi-spoke design, finished in satin black hue.

On board, the Shelby Mach-E is laden with a slew of Shelby exclusive equipment. This includes the many Shelby emblems and badges, special numbered dash plaque that denotes the exact model number of the car, as well as Shelby-badged floor mats. 

Interestingly, this model sports a novel Borla Active Performance Sound System, which produces a fake engine noise that mirrors the car’s actual driving speed and RPM level, giving an illusion that you’re driving an ICE-powered Shelby Mustang instead of an all-electric one.


The Shelby Mustang Mach-E GT is now available for sale as a performance package in the European market, which fetches a price tag of €24,900 (RM), excluding the Ford Mustang Mach-E GT base car price.

To commemorate Carroll Shelby’s 100th birthday, only 100 units of the Shelby Mustang Mach-E GT will be available, with its production set to commence in July this year, while deliveries are expected to begin much later this year.
